当前位置: 移动技术网 > IT编程>数据库>Mysql > 数据库迁移导致Unknown character set: 'GBK' 应用异常

数据库迁移导致Unknown character set: 'GBK' 应用异常

2019年11月22日  | 移动技术网IT编程  | 我要评论
https://blog.csdn.net/u013415591/article/details/82692242https://blog.csdn.net/gx_1_11_real/article/details/81066336 迁移之前没这个问题,原来迁移后没将lower_case_table ...

https://blog.csdn.net/u013415591/article/details/82692242
https://blog.csdn.net/gx_1_11_real/article/details/81066336

迁移之前没这个问题,原来迁移后没将lower_case_table_names加上,mysql有点矫情,严格区分大小写。。。
12:08:19,494 [error]-[com.alibaba.druid.filter.logging.log4jfilter statementlogerror 152]-{conn-10088, pstmt-169279} execute error. select t.region_id, t.region_name, t.region_name_en, t.region_code2, t.region_code3 from t_region t where t.is_black = 0 and t.parent_id = ? order by t.sort_order, convert(trim(t.region_name_en) using gbk) asc
com.mysql.jdbc.exceptions.jdbc4.mysqlsyntaxerrorexception: unknown character set: 'gbk'

vi /etc/my.cnf
增加
lower_case_table_names=1

service mysqld start

如您对本文有疑问或者有任何想说的,请 点击进行留言回复,万千网友为您解惑!

相关文章:

验证码:
移动技术网